  • Low-Carb Meanings

    adjective describing a diet or food that is low in carbohydrates

    Fields related to low-carb

    Cooking

    Low-carb recipes typically involve using ingredients that are low in carbohydrates, such as vegetables, lean proteins, and healthy fats.

    Fitness

    Low-carb diets are often used by athletes and fitness enthusiasts to optimize performance and body composition.

    Nutrition

    Low-carb diets focus on reducing carbohydrate intake to promote weight loss and improve overall health.

    Health

    Low-carb diets have been associated with various health benefits, including improved blood sugar control and reduced risk of chronic diseases.
